  • Patent number: 11000043
    Abstract: A domestic baking device for baking a food product, in particular a flat bread, from a dough portion initially held in a portion capsule (2), the domestic baking device comprising a baking apparatus for baking the dough portion and a capsule-emptying apparatus (7) for removing the dough portion from a portion capsule (2), the capsule-emptying apparatus (7) having at least one force application element, which can be moved along a movement path, for applying force to, in particular deforming and/or moving, the portion capsule (2), which force application element can be driven by means of an electric motor, characterized in that the capsule-emptying apparatus (7) is assigned monitoring means for monitoring the portion capsule emptying operation, the monitoring means comprising comparing means, which are designed to monitor the curve of an electrical motor signal, in particular a current or voltage signal, over the movement path of the force application element for the reaching or exceeding of a reference signal
    Type: Grant
    Filed: March 2, 2017
    Date of Patent: May 11, 2021
    Assignee: Eugster / Frismag AG
    Inventors: Wolfgang Riessbeck, Simon Wäger, Christof Zwahlen
  • Publication number: 20200163346
    Abstract: A domestic baking device for baking a food product, in particular a flat bread, made of a dough portion which is first received in a portion capsule. The baking device includes a baking and pressing device (2) for baking and pressing the dough portion (3, 3?) between a first and a second baking plate (5). At least the first baking plate (4) can be driven relative to the second baking plate (5) along a preferably linear displacement path (s) towards the second baking plate (5) by means of adjusting means (7) which include an electric motor in order to flatten the dough portion (3, 3?) by pressing same between the baking plates (4, 5).
    Type: Application
    Filed: March 27, 2017
    Publication date: May 28, 2020
    Applicant: Flatev AG
    Inventors: Wolfgang Riessbeck, Simon Wäger, Christof Zwahlen

  • Publication number: 20100089244
    Abstract: An electric beverage making machine including a control unit and at least one electric function unit for a process of making the beverage. For the power supply to the function unit and to the control unit, a first switching contact having an actuation element and a power supply are provided in a power supply circuit. Parallel to the first switching contact, a second switching contact is provided which is actuated by the control unit. The first switching contact is a two-way contact having a power supply contact and a control contact which is connected with an input of the control unit and can alternatingly make contact with the power supply contact.
    Type: Application
    Filed: October 14, 2009
    Publication date: April 15, 2010
    Inventor: Christof Zwahlen
